Notice
Recent Posts
Recent Comments
Link
|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| ||||
| 4 | 5 | 6 | 7 | 8 | 9 | 10 |
| 11 | 12 | 13 | 14 | 15 | 16 | 17 |
| 18 | 19 | 20 | 21 | 22 | 23 | 24 |
| 25 | 26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 어노테이션
- 의존주입
- 생성자주입
- 비즈니스레이어
- jointpoint
- @RequestParam
- springjdbc
- gradle
- PointCut
- .xml
- springmvc
- 유효성검사
- @ResponseBody
- Model
- produces
- 서비스레이어
- after-throwing
- 바인딩변수
- c:if
- MVC
- Java
- 스프링
- @Valid
- @
- frontController
- SpringBoot
- spring
- AOP
- application.properties
- @RequestMapping
Archives
- Today
- Total
메모장
SweetAlert 적용하기 본문
728x90
반응형
우리 프로젝트 파일에 SweetAlert 를 추가 해보았다.
우리가 추가해야 할 부분은 '로그인 성공/실패' , '회원가입 성공/실패' , '결제하기 성공/실패' , '아이디찾기 성공/실패' , '회원정보 변경 성공' 이렇게 5가지 이다.
처음엔 5가지로 나눠서 로그인 알림.jsp , 회원가입 알림.jsp , 결제하기 알림.jsp , 아이디찾기 알림.jsp, 회원정보변경 알림.jsp 개별로 만들어야 한다고 생각했다.
그러나 jsp 파일도 결국 서블릿 파일이기 때문에 많이 생기면 무거워 지기 때문에 (자원이 많이 든다, 메모리가 많이 든다.) 많이 만들지 않는 것이 좋다.
그래서 방법 !!
모든 알림창은 틀이 비슷하기 때문에 jsp 페이지는 성공 실패로만 나눈다.

이제 모든 성공과 실패는 SweetAlert.jsp 로 들어온다 !
방법 1. VO 객체에 임시변수로 만들기
MemberVO 에 임시변수 선언
성공/실패 여부 나누기, 보낼 메세지 , 보낼 경로

회원가입.do 컨트롤러에서

success/fail , 멘트 , 경로 set 보내주기
세개 합쳐서 mVO 객체 넘기기
방법 2. Model 객체 사용해서 값 넘겨주기

String 타입의 변수 선언 후 성공/실패 여부, 멘트, 경로

728x90
반응형
'JavaScript > 개념정리' 카테고리의 다른 글
| JSON 이란 ? (0) | 2024.04.24 |
|---|---|
| SweetAlert 꾸미기 (0) | 2024.04.24 |
| JavaScript 05 < ajax() 메서드 > (0) | 2024.04.23 |
| JavaScript 04 <jQuery> (0) | 2024.04.23 |
| JavaScript 03 < JS 실습문제 > (0) | 2024.04.22 |